Lines Matching refs:P9Req
37 } P9Req; typedef
107 P9Req *req;
129 P9Req *req;
156 P9Req *req;
182 P9Req *req;
212 P9Req *req;
239 P9Req *req;
265 P9Req *req;
287 P9Req *req;
320 P9Req *req;
355 P9Req *req;
387 P9Req *req;
415 P9Req *req;
441 P9Req *req;
445 void v9fs_memwrite(P9Req *req, const void *addr, size_t len);
446 void v9fs_memskip(P9Req *req, size_t len);
447 void v9fs_memread(P9Req *req, void *addr, size_t len);
448 void v9fs_uint8_read(P9Req *req, uint8_t *val);
449 void v9fs_uint16_write(P9Req *req, uint16_t val);
450 void v9fs_uint16_read(P9Req *req, uint16_t *val);
451 void v9fs_uint32_write(P9Req *req, uint32_t val);
452 void v9fs_uint64_write(P9Req *req, uint64_t val);
453 void v9fs_uint32_read(P9Req *req, uint32_t *val);
454 void v9fs_uint64_read(P9Req *req, uint64_t *val);
456 void v9fs_string_write(P9Req *req, const char *string);
457 void v9fs_string_read(P9Req *req, uint16_t *len, char **string);
458 P9Req *v9fs_req_init(QVirtio9P *v9p, uint32_t size, uint8_t id,
460 void v9fs_req_send(P9Req *req);
461 void v9fs_req_wait_for_reply(P9Req *req, uint32_t *len);
462 void v9fs_req_recv(P9Req *req, uint8_t id);
463 void v9fs_req_free(P9Req *req);
464 void v9fs_rlerror(P9Req *req, uint32_t *err);
466 void v9fs_rversion(P9Req *req, uint16_t *len, char **version);
468 void v9fs_rattach(P9Req *req, v9fs_qid *qid);
470 void v9fs_rwalk(P9Req *req, uint16_t *nwqid, v9fs_qid **wqid);
472 void v9fs_rgetattr(P9Req *req, v9fs_attr *attr);
474 void v9fs_rreaddir(P9Req *req, uint32_t *count, uint32_t *nentries,
478 void v9fs_rlopen(P9Req *req, v9fs_qid *qid, uint32_t *iounit);
480 void v9fs_rwrite(P9Req *req, uint32_t *count);
482 void v9fs_rflush(P9Req *req);
484 void v9fs_rmkdir(P9Req *req, v9fs_qid *qid);
486 void v9fs_rlcreate(P9Req *req, v9fs_qid *qid, uint32_t *iounit);
488 void v9fs_rsymlink(P9Req *req, v9fs_qid *qid);
490 void v9fs_rlink(P9Req *req);
492 void v9fs_runlinkat(P9Req *req);